Small Group Activities

The theme for the next two weeks is nursery rhymes. The children will be introduced to a variety of common nursery rhymes and will participate in fun activities related to the rhymes.

In our literacy small groups this week, the morning class will work on solving simple riddles with picture clues. This activity will encourage listening comprehension and following directions. The afternoon class will work on identifying rhyming words with a “Little Jack Horner” plum pie rhyming game. Both classes will also have the opportunity to use flannel board pieces to help retell favorite nursery rhymes like “Jack and Jill,” “Little Boy Blue,” “Hey Diddle, Diddle,” and “Little Miss Muffet.” In our math groups this week, the children will work on shape identification. The morning class will play a game called “Where’s Teddy?” where they will be presented with a pocket chart full of shape cards, one of which has a teddy bear picture hiding behind it. They will need to name a shape and then see if the bear is hiding behind it. Shapes used in the game will be a circle, square, and triangle. The afternoon class will play a “Queen of Hearts” shape game with shapes like circles, ovals, triangles, rectangles, diamonds, hearts, pentagons, and hexagons.

In the art center this week, the children will practice their cutting and coloring skills as they make a plum pie to learn the rhyme “Little Jack Horner.” They will also begin work on a Humpty Dumpty craft to be displayed in the hallway.
